Bruno Raffin is a scholar working on Computer Graphics and Computer-Aided Design,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and Computer Networks and Communications. According to data from OpenAlex, Bruno Raffin has authored 30 papers receiving a total of 304 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Computer Graphics and Computer-Aided Design, 11 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and 9 papers in Computer Networks and Communications. Recurrent topics in Bruno Raffin’s work include Computer Graphics and Visualization Techniques (13 papers), 3D Shape Modeling and Analysis (8 papers) and Advanced Vision and Imaging (7 papers). Bruno Raffin is often cited by papers focused on Computer Graphics and Visualization Techniques (13 papers), 3D Shape Modeling and Analysis (8 papers) and Advanced Vision and Imaging (7 papers). Bruno Raffin collaborates with scholars based in France, Brazil and Puerto Rico. Bruno Raffin's co-authors include Edmond Boyer, Clément Menier, Jérémie Allard, Jean-Sébastien Franco, François Fauré, Marc Baaden, Matthieu Chavent, Alex Tek, Nicolas Férey and Mirta B. Gordon and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Computational Chemistry, IEEE Access and Neural Computation.
